Max to min heap
Web5 feb. 2024 · There are two types of heaps: Min-heap and Max-heap. A min-heap is used to access the minimum element in the heap whereas the Max-heap is used when … Web8 jul. 2009 · Java has good tools in order to implement min and max heaps. My suggestion is using the priority queue data structure in order to implement these heaps. For implementing the max heap with priority queue try this: import java.util.PriorityQueue; public class MaxHeapWithPriorityQueue { public static void main (String args []) { // create …
Max to min heap
Did you know?
Web27 jul. 2011 · When you set the maximum, it allocates that amount of virtual memory on start up. However, the amount of memory used grows slowly as the heap is used. Even … WebConvert max heap to min heap in linear time Given an array representing a max-heap, in-place convert it into the min-heap in linear time. Practice this problem The idea is simple …
WebAccording to this condition, there are two types of heaps – max-heap & min-heap that are discussed below. Types of Heap Data Structure 1. Min-heap: If in a complete binary … WebLearn how we can insert within our Binary Min/Max Heap. We're going to be implementing our insert method, by using array as our underlying data structure. We...
Web13 apr. 2024 · Heap. Max Heap : (1) Complete binary tree (2) Key of each node is no smaller than its children’s keys; Min Heap : (1) Complete binary tree (2) key of each node is no larger than its children’s keys. 차이점 : Max heap vs. BST; Examples : Max Heap; Root of a max heap always has the largest value; Examples : Not a Max Heap; Examples : … Web26 apr. 2015 · 1 Answer. Sorted by: 1. try to go throught tree by levels, starting with lowest node. If your heap is represented by array, it will be simple. 1. step. comparing 1 with 6, …
WebTo create a Max-Heap: MaxHeap (array, size) loop from the first index of non-leaf node down to zero call heapify For Min-Heap, both leftChild and rightChild must be larger than …
Web3 jan. 2024 · Min Max Heaps - A min-max heap is defined as a complete binary tree containing alternating min (or even) and max (or odd) levels. Even levels are denoted as for example 0, 2, 4, etc, and odd levels are denoted as 1, 3, 5, etc.We consider in the next points that the root element is at the first level, i.e., 0.Exampl nanny prices per hourWebIn computer science, a heap is a specialized tree-based data structure which is essentially an almost complete binary tree that satisfies the heap property: in a max heap, for any given node C, if P is a parent node of C, then the key (the value) of P is greater than or equal to the key of C.In a min heap, the key of P is less than or equal to the key of C. … megwin technologyWeb12 apr. 2024 · In this video we will explore the Heap Data Structure which is a very important Data Structure in Computer Science including Minimum Heap and Maximum Heap an... meg winterburn dewsburyWeb11 apr. 2024 · Priority-queue. Heaps: A heap is a specific tree based data structure in which all the nodes of tree are in a specific order. Let’s say if X is a parent node of Y, then the value of X follows some specific order with respect to value of Y and the same order will be followed across the tree. The maximum number of children of a node in the heap ... meg winning numbers and other winningsWebIn this article, we will learn more about Min Heap (known as heap queue in Python). We have already learned about Heap and its library functions (in heapq module) in python.We will now learn about min-heap and its implementation and then look at the Python code for implementing the heapify, heappush and heappop functions ourselves. Let’s do a quick … megwinoffWebsort. returns a list of sorted values in O (n*log (n)) runtime, based on the comparison logic, and in reverse order. In MaxHeap it returns the list of sorted values in ascending order, and in descending order in MinHeap. sort mutates the node positions in the heap, to prevent that, you can sort a clone of the heap. megwithloveWeb15 nov. 2024 · A heap data structure in computer science is a special tree that satisfies the heap property, this just means that the parent is less than or equal to the child node for a minimum heap... meg winterbotham